About Muhammet Çalık

Muhammet Çalık is a scholar working on Microbiology, Pathology and Forensic Medicine and Endocrine and Autonomic Systems, having authored 42 papers that have together received 625 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Traumatic Brain Injury and Neurovascular Disturbances (6 papers), Cancer, Hypoxia, and Metabolism (4 papers) and Intracranial Aneurysms: Treatment and Complications (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Physiology (47 citations), Pathology and Forensic Medicine (166 citations) and Neurology (97 citations). Muhammet Çalık has collaborated with scholars based in Türkiye, United States and Russia. Frequent co-authors include Yasin Bayır, Mevlüt Albayrak, İlhami Gülçın, İlknur Çalık, Ayhan Kanat, Mehmet Dumlu Aydın, İbrahim Hanifi Özercan, Elif Demirci, Mecit Kantarcı and Suat Eren.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, European Respiratory Journal and Radiographics.
